Adidas Originals Samba X-Wing x Star Wars

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 08:30 PM PST

Adidas Originals Samba X Wing x Star Wars
The Star Wars-inspired Samba from Adidas Originals is now an in demand design to all the fanatics. Dubbing it as the “X-Wing” to represent the fictional starfighter from the original Star Wars trilogy and the Star Wars Expanded Universe, it features a mid panel with the design identical to the side of the fighter. It has Grey suede toe and heel panel with bits of wreck on the toe. An “X-Wing” label appears on the side panel while an Adidas/X-Wing logo comes out from the tongue. [NiceKicks]

Nike Air Force 1 Bespoke x Anthony Terry

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 08:01 PM PST

Nike Air Force 1 Bespoke x Anthony Terry
One of the best Nike Air Force 1 Bespoke created lately was designed by Anthony Terry. With this particular sneaker, we can see a glowing twisted croc-textured toebox, lace holder section and Swoosh, Brown diamond leather on the collar and heel areas, suede on the toe, and waxed canvas mid panel. The MX midsole gives the sneaker a more fancy look while the outsole is finished in Orange. [NiceKicks]

Adidas Originals Tech Pack

Posted: 05 Jan 2010 09:09 PM PST

Adidas Originals Tech Pack
Adidas proudly brings another lineup of sneakers in new designs - the Adidas Originals Tech Pack, featuring the Rod Laver, Samba, and Superstar models. Each shoe is done up in Black leather upper with a zigzag teeth design on the midsole which comes in size variation. Blue pops up on the heel tab as it goes with the Blue inner liner. [NiceKicks]

Nike iD Air Max 1 New Color Options

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 12:58 PM PST

Nike iD Air Max 1 New Color Options

The Nike Air Max 1 is a long-time favorite of runner and sneakerheads alike. Aside from its retro release in OG colors this past year, the AM1 kept things going by being added to the Nike iD design studio. But recently, Nike added yet another option, as some new colors just made their way onto the palette.

Marina Blue and Electric Green both became available on multiple areas of the shoe. In addition to that, Julep was also added for the different parts of the upper. Julep will appear on a 1 later this year, as previewed in our Sportswear Spring Preview, but this options means you can vary your look a little, and go custom with a pair. Air Jordan 9 Retro 2010 Preview

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 12:28 PM PST

Air Jordan 9 Retro 2010 Preview

Last week, we showcased the Air Jordan 9 Retro “Citrus” as part of the 10 Sneakers We’re Looking Forward to in 2010, and many of you expressed your excitement for the return of the Air Jordan 9. With that said, there will be at least two more Air Jordan 9 colorways that will surface this year.

First off, Jordan Brand will release the aforementioned Air Jordan 9 “Citrus” during the summer. However, in the fall, we will see the release of the two classic Air Jordan 9 colorways in the form of the white/black-red (August 2010) and the “Charcoal” (September 2010). The latter colorway hasn’t been seen since it first released in 1994, while the white/black-red Air Jordan 9s were just seen in 2008 as part of the Countdown Packs. Nike Blazer Low AC Grey/Teal

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 11:58 AM PST

Nike Blazer Low AC

The velcro-strapped Nike Blazer has been a well-received model since we first saw its debut. From the black leather Lux V to the Dark Cinder Highs, the straps have proven attractive not only to the lazy, but also to the regular sneakerhead.

This pair we see here hasn’t released, but is available on eBay in sample size 9. Teal accents appear on the tongue label, on the sock liner and in leather on the Swoosh. Unlike the High models we see linked above, the Low AC features only three straps, but does feature the same vulcanized and textured sole.

Reebok Basquiat Untitled

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 11:28 AM PST

Reebok Basquiat Untitled

In 2009, Reebok released a few sneakers designed by Jean Michel Basquiat, namely the Ex-O-Fit. Basquiat now applies his designs to yet another Reebok silhouette in the form of this running model.

This particular sneaker can potentially turn heads thanks to its rich green leather that makes up 100% of the base. It also owns some hints of gold throughout the upper as well. However, its most distinctive attributes are seen in the form of unidentified scripts written on the midsole and heel. Other features include white shoelaces, a monochromatic Reebok logo on the side panels and the word Basquiat written on the tongue. Nike Air Footscape Black/Medium Grey-Electric Green

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 10:58 AM PST

nike-air-footscape-2

The Nike Air Footscape has proven to be a very love-it or hate-it silhouette. With its crooked midfoot and laces, moccasin design and overall unique look, this shoe has garnered a lot of followers and as many haters. The best way to further a shoe like this one’s ongoing reputation? Dress it in bright green.

The upper uses Electric Green for the majority of the upper, while black is used on the toe. The midsole is done in white with a black outsole, while hits of grey are used throughout, including the plastic semi-transparent piece on the heel.

Reebok Pump AxtPlus Black/Gold-White

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 10:28 AM PST

Reebok Pump AxtPlus Black/Gold-White

This past year, Reebok brought its Pump technology back into limelight by unveiling its Pump 20 Program and re-releasing the “Bringbacks”. However, if you’re looking for an alternative to those respective sneakers, Reebok has now unleashed the Pump AxtPlus at select retailers such as CaliRoots.

Although this Reebok sneaker is not as popular as the aforementioned models, it still is considered a quality shoe. The Reebok Pump AxtPlus is a very comfortable sneaker seeing that it incorporates HexRide technology. As for the colorway, this shoe owns a predominately black leather base with multiple gold accents including the Pump on the tongue. It is also finished with a white midsole giving a nice, clean look. Nike Lunar Rejuven8 Mid+ Black/Varsity Maize

Posted: 06 Jan 2010 09:58 AM PST

nike-lunar-rejuven8-mid-blackvarsity-maize-lead

Torch is finally making its debut in various Nike models to start 2010. We took a full look at this new material in an Air Force 1 and an Air Maxim 1, and also in the Rejuven8 Mid. What we’re seeing here is another colorway of the latter shoe, done in a LIVESTRONG-esque colorway.

This shoe was designed for footballers (”soccer players” here in the States) to wear after practice and games for ultimate comfort. The Lunarlite sole is done completely in Varsity Maize, and includes Nike+ technology. The upper’s done in black completely. The mesh weave material that covers the shoe’s Torch infrastructure matches up with nubuck on the heel, Swoosh and midfoot. These have hit select retailers, but are available online at Kix-Files.
